M.M. El-Wakil's "Powerplant Technology" is a foundational textbook in mechanical and nuclear engineering, widely regarded for its comprehensive and balanced treatment of modern energy generation systems. First published in 1984, the book remains a critical reference for students and professionals seeking to understand the analytical and technological aspects of power plant design. 4. Key Features and Pedagogical Approach
The Component-to-System Approach El-Wakil teaches the student to think modularly. He explains the internal workings of a specific component (e.g., a deaerator or a superheater) and then demonstrates how that component affects the overall plant heat rate and efficiency. - Step 1 – Master Chapter 2 (Review of Thermodynamics): Don’t skip this, even if you think you know it. El-Wakil uses a unique notation for availability (exergy) that is crucial later.
- Step 2 – Work the Rankine Cycle Problems (Chapter 3): Do not just read; calculate. Use NIST or IAPWS software to verify your steam properties.
- Step 3 – Focus on the Combined Cycle (Chapter 12): This is the future of fossil power. Understand why the heat recovery steam generator (HRSG) is the critical component.
- Step 4 – Compare Nuclear to Fossil (Chapters 8-10): Memorize the safety differences and thermodynamic limitations (e.g., why nuclear plants operate at lower steam temperatures).
